Transaction 1123fb6195f64e4fe2a6cf353a4958e6847658690fb9e46bb9390d93d68b5e8d
1 Input
2 Outputs
- 1123fb6195f64e4fe2a6cf353a4958e6847658690fb9e46bb9390d93d68b5e8d:0
- 1123fb6195f64e4fe2a6cf353a4958e6847658690fb9e46bb9390d93d68b5e8d:1
value 475778
address 13fLwSLrBmosn1pg93ii179yncdNVxFoyh
value 912542
address 139Kyx2disMBBdrenCZmnEHok63foW3PvT